**Design and Functionality**

Unlike conventional bucket teeth that are welded permanently to the bucket, the new bolt-on teeth are secured with heavy-duty bolts, making it straightforward to remove and install each tooth individually. This modular approach means that damaged or excessively worn teeth can be replaced on the spot, with minimal tools and no need for skilled welders or specialized repair shops.

The design of the teeth features reinforced tips engineered to withstand high-impact digging and abrasive soil conditions. Crafted from high-quality wear-resistant steel alloys, these bolt-on teeth maintain their sharpness and structural integrity longer than typical bucket teeth, contributing to better penetration in tough soils and reducing fuel consumption by minimizing digging resistance.

**Economic and Operational Benefits**

For owners and operators of tractors, particularly those engaged in construction, farming, landscaping, and earth-moving projects, the introduction of bolt-on teeth significantly streamlines maintenance schedules. The ability to replace individual teeth quickly means that tractors spend more time working and less time idle due to repair.

Moreover, the cost savings are considerable. Welding on new teeth often involves hiring specialized labor and can require taking the machinery to repair shops, leading to downtime and additional expenses. The bolt-on configuration eliminates these overheads and extends the practical service life of the bucket, offering substantial long-term savings.
